jdbc实验心得
JDBC实验心得
一、实验背景和目的
JDBC(Java Database Connectivity)是Java语言访问数据库的标准接口,通过JDBC可以方便地连接和操作各种类型的数据库。本次实验旨在通过编写Java程序使用JDBC连接数据库,并进行数据的增删改查操作,加深对JDBC的理解和掌握。
二、实验过程
1. 环境准备:首先需要安装并配置好Java开发环境,包括JDK和IDE(如Eclipse或IntelliJ IDEA)。然后下载并安装相应版本的数据库驱动程序,如MySQL Connector/J。
2. 创建数据库:根据实验需求,可以选择已有的数据库或创建新的数据库。如果选择创建新的数据库,需要执行相应的SQL语句来创建表结构。
3. 导入驱动程序:将下载好的驱动程序导入到项目中,并在代码中引入相应的包。
4. 连接数据库:使用DriverManager类中的getConnection()方法来建立与数据库之间的连接。需要提供数据库URL、用户名和密码等连接信息。
5. 执行SQL语句:通过Connection对象创建Statement对象,并使用Statement对象执行SQL语句。可以执行查询语句、更新语句等不同类型的SQL语句。
6. 处理结果集:如果执行查询语句,则会返回一个ResultSet对象,可以通过ResultSet对象获取查询结果集中的数据。
7. 关闭资源:在完成所有操作后,需要关闭ResultSet、Statement和Connection等资源,释放内存。
三、实验收获
1. 掌握JDBC的基本使用方法:通过本次实验,我了解了JDBC的基本使用方法,包括建立数据库连接、执行SQL语句和处理结果集等。
2. 熟悉常用的JDBC API:在实验过程中,我熟悉了一些常用的JDBC API,如DriverManager类、Connection接口、Statement接口和ResultSet接口等。
3. 理解数据库事务:在进行数据操作时,我学会了使用事务来确保数据的一致性和完整性。通过设置自动提交或手动提交事务,可以控制数据操作的原子性。
4. 错误处理和异常处理:在实验中,我遇到了一些错误和异常情况。通过对这些错误和异常进行适当处理,可以提高程序的健壮性和容错性。
5. 优化数据库访问性能:通过对SQL语句进行优化、合理使用数据库连接池等方式,可以提高数据库访问的效率和性能。
四、实验总结
通过本次实验,我深入学习了JDBC的使用方法,并成功完成了与数据库的连接以及数据操作。同时,我也意识到JDBC是一个非常重要且强大的工具,在Java开发中起着至关重要的作用。掌握好JDBC可以使我们更加灵活地操作数据库,提高开发效率和质量。
java的jdbc连接数据库在今后的学习和工作中,我将继续深入研究JDBC的更高级用法,如PreparedStatement、CallableStatement等,以及与其他框架(如Spring)的整合,进一步提升自己的技术水平。同时,我也会不断学习和探索新兴的数据库技术和相关工具,以适应不断变化的需求和挑战。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论